Application Developer-TULSA
Serves as primary contact for Inventory Control of Tulsa IT’s hardware hosted in multiple CMDBs. Maintains IT’s webpages on the OU-Tulsa website. Coordinates with the manager the IT Store warehouse for School of Community Medicine/OU Physicians to include ordering, shelving, creating CMDB assets, coordinating deployment with Mission Support, providing monthly billing and inventory reports. Provides technical documentation for IT teams, as well as ITSM documentation.
Essential Duties:
Develops new software applications and updates and modifies existing applications as required by the customer. Processes user needs to customize software for computer programs, designs prototype applications, implements and tests source code, and troubleshoots software applications.
• Designs prototypes according to customer specifications.
• Develops software solutions to meet customer needs.
• Creates and implements the source code of new applications.
• Tests source code and debugs code.
• Evaluates existing applications and performs updates and modifications.
• Develops technical handbooks to represent the design and code of new applications.
• Performs various duties as needed to successfully fulfill the function of the position.
